Another page that contains some information is
http://developer.android.com/reference/android/R.attr.html which
appears to list all XML attributes for all elements.  Unfortunately,
this list doesn't include any information about which elements the
attribute goes with.  Thickness attribute, for example, is meant to be
used with <shape anroid:shape="ring" android:thickness="3.5sp"> and it
doesn't make much sense in a LinearLayout element <LinearLayout
android:thickness="3.5sp">.
